.partner-hero[data-astro-cid-gt4hgkkn]{position:relative;min-height:var(--brand-shared-hero-min-height);height:var(--brand-shared-hero-min-height);overflow:hidden;background:var(--color-soft)}.hero-media[data-astro-cid-gt4hgkkn],.hero-media[data-astro-cid-gt4hgkkn] img[data-astro-cid-gt4hgkkn]{position:absolute;inset:0;width:100%;height:100%}.hero-media[data-astro-cid-gt4hgkkn] img[data-astro-cid-gt4hgkkn]{object-fit:cover;object-position:center center}.partner-hero[data-astro-cid-gt4hgkkn]:after{position:absolute;inset:0;background:linear-gradient(90deg,#ffffffb8,#ffffff1f 58%,#fff0);content:""}.hero-copy[data-astro-cid-gt4hgkkn]{position:relative;z-index:1}.hero-copy[data-astro-cid-gt4hgkkn]>[data-astro-cid-gt4hgkkn]{max-width:430px}.hero-copy[data-astro-cid-gt4hgkkn] .lead[data-astro-cid-gt4hgkkn]{white-space:pre-line;line-height:1.95}.hero-copy[data-astro-cid-gt4hgkkn] .page-title[data-astro-cid-gt4hgkkn]{margin:14px 0 18px;font-size:var(--page-title-size);line-height:40px}.hero-cta[data-astro-cid-gt4hgkkn],.secondary-link[data-astro-cid-gt4hgkkn]{display:inline-flex;align-items:center;justify-content:center;min-height:46px;padding:0 24px;font-size:var(--button-text-size);font-weight:var(--body-weight);letter-spacing:var(--button-letter-spacing);line-height:20px}.hero-cta[data-astro-cid-gt4hgkkn]{background:var(--color-cta);color:var(--color-cta-text)}.secondary-link[data-astro-cid-gt4hgkkn]{border:1px solid var(--color-border);color:var(--color-muted);background:#ffffffbd}.proposal-section[data-astro-cid-gt4hgkkn]{position:relative;overflow:hidden;background:linear-gradient(90deg,#ffffff3d,#ffffff61 36%,#ffffffad 58%,#ffffffd1),url(/assets/beauty-partner/proposal/proposal-section-bg.png) center / cover no-repeat}.proposal-copy-shell[data-astro-cid-gt4hgkkn]{min-height:460px;display:grid;align-items:center}.proposal-mobile-visual[data-astro-cid-gt4hgkkn]{display:none}.proposal-copy[data-astro-cid-gt4hgkkn]{max-width:398px;margin-left:auto;padding:clamp(40px,4vw,56px) 0}.proposal-copy[data-astro-cid-gt4hgkkn] .section-title[data-astro-cid-gt4hgkkn],.cta-copy[data-astro-cid-gt4hgkkn] h2[data-astro-cid-gt4hgkkn]{margin-bottom:18px}.proposal-lead[data-astro-cid-gt4hgkkn]{max-width:100%;white-space:pre-line;line-height:1.95}.proposal-copy[data-astro-cid-gt4hgkkn] .secondary-link[data-astro-cid-gt4hgkkn]{margin-top:18px}.proposal-copy[data-astro-cid-gt4hgkkn] .beauty-partner-proposal-line-button[data-astro-cid-gt4hgkkn]{min-width:230px;min-height:54px;padding:14px 34px;border:1px solid #262626;background:#ffffffeb;color:#262626;font-family:var(--font-body);font-size:15px;font-weight:300;letter-spacing:.22em;line-height:1;text-decoration:none;opacity:1;transition:background-color .28s ease,color .28s ease,border-color .28s ease,opacity .28s ease,box-shadow .28s ease,transform .28s ease}.proposal-copy[data-astro-cid-gt4hgkkn] .beauty-partner-proposal-line-button[data-astro-cid-gt4hgkkn]:hover,.proposal-copy[data-astro-cid-gt4hgkkn] .beauty-partner-proposal-line-button[data-astro-cid-gt4hgkkn]:focus-visible{background:#262626;border-color:#262626;color:#fff;opacity:1;box-shadow:none;transform:none}.proposal-copy[data-astro-cid-gt4hgkkn] .beauty-partner-proposal-line-button[data-astro-cid-gt4hgkkn]:focus-visible{outline:2px solid rgba(38,38,38,.28);outline-offset:3px}.center-copy[data-astro-cid-gt4hgkkn]{max-width:620px;margin:0 auto 40px;text-align:center}.benefit-grid[data-astro-cid-gt4hgkkn]{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:28px}.benefit-card[data-astro-cid-gt4hgkkn]{overflow:hidden;background:transparent;box-shadow:none}.benefit-card[data-astro-cid-gt4hgkkn] img[data-astro-cid-gt4hgkkn]{width:100%;aspect-ratio:4 / 3;object-fit:cover;object-position:center center}.benefit-copy[data-astro-cid-gt4hgkkn]{padding:22px 22px 20px;background:#f8f7f7;text-align:center}.benefit-card[data-astro-cid-gt4hgkkn] h3[data-astro-cid-gt4hgkkn],.cta-copy[data-astro-cid-gt4hgkkn] h2[data-astro-cid-gt4hgkkn]{margin:0 0 10px;color:var(--color-ink);font-family:var(--font-serif);font-size:var(--card-title-size);font-weight:var(--title-weight);letter-spacing:var(--card-title-letter-spacing);line-height:var(--card-title-line-height)}.benefit-card[data-astro-cid-gt4hgkkn] p[data-astro-cid-gt4hgkkn],.cta-copy[data-astro-cid-gt4hgkkn] p[data-astro-cid-gt4hgkkn]{margin:0;color:var(--color-text);font-size:var(--description-text-size);font-weight:var(--body-weight);letter-spacing:var(--description-letter-spacing);line-height:1.9}.partner-cta[data-astro-cid-gt4hgkkn]{position:relative;min-height:520px;display:grid;align-items:center;overflow:hidden}.partner-cta[data-astro-cid-gt4hgkkn]>img[data-astro-cid-gt4hgkkn]{position:absolute;inset:0;width:100%;height:100%;object-fit:cover}.cta-copy[data-astro-cid-gt4hgkkn]{position:relative;z-index:1}.cta-copy[data-astro-cid-gt4hgkkn]>[data-astro-cid-gt4hgkkn]{max-width:360px}.cta-copy[data-astro-cid-gt4hgkkn] h2[data-astro-cid-gt4hgkkn]{font-size:var(--section-title-size);letter-spacing:var(--title-letter-spacing);line-height:1.3}.cta-copy[data-astro-cid-gt4hgkkn] p[data-astro-cid-gt4hgkkn]{font-size:calc(var(--description-text-size) + 2px);line-height:2}.cta-copy[data-astro-cid-gt4hgkkn] .hero-cta[data-astro-cid-gt4hgkkn]{margin-top:30px}@media(max-width:960px){.benefit-grid[data-astro-cid-gt4hgkkn]{grid-template-columns:1fr;gap:36px}.proposal-copy-shell[data-astro-cid-gt4hgkkn]{min-height:420px}.proposal-copy[data-astro-cid-gt4hgkkn]{max-width:420px}}@media(max-width:640px){.proposal-section[data-astro-cid-gt4hgkkn]{background:#f8f7f7;padding-top:12px}.proposal-mobile-visual[data-astro-cid-gt4hgkkn]{display:block;width:calc(100% - 16px);margin:0 auto;aspect-ratio:358 / 304;object-fit:cover;object-position:center}.proposal-copy-shell[data-astro-cid-gt4hgkkn]{min-height:auto;align-items:start}.proposal-copy[data-astro-cid-gt4hgkkn]{max-width:100%;margin-left:0;padding:34px 0 6px}.proposal-copy[data-astro-cid-gt4hgkkn] .secondary-link[data-astro-cid-gt4hgkkn]{margin-top:18px}.proposal-copy[data-astro-cid-gt4hgkkn] .beauty-partner-proposal-line-button[data-astro-cid-gt4hgkkn]{min-width:0;max-width:100%;min-height:48px;padding:11px 24px}.partner-hero[data-astro-cid-gt4hgkkn]{min-height:760px;align-items:start;padding-block:0 28px}.partner-hero[data-astro-cid-gt4hgkkn]:after{content:none}.hero-media[data-astro-cid-gt4hgkkn] img[data-astro-cid-gt4hgkkn]{object-position:center top}.hero-copy[data-astro-cid-gt4hgkkn]{width:calc(100% - (var(--mobile-padding) * 2));padding-top:146px;padding-right:0}.hero-copy[data-astro-cid-gt4hgkkn]>[data-astro-cid-gt4hgkkn]{max-width:292px}.hero-copy[data-astro-cid-gt4hgkkn] .page-title[data-astro-cid-gt4hgkkn]{margin:10px 0 14px;font-size:clamp(28px,7.4vw,32px)}.benefit-copy[data-astro-cid-gt4hgkkn]{padding:18px 16px}.partner-cta[data-astro-cid-gt4hgkkn]{min-height:360px}.cta-copy[data-astro-cid-gt4hgkkn] h2[data-astro-cid-gt4hgkkn]{font-size:clamp(26px,6.8vw,30px)}.cta-copy[data-astro-cid-gt4hgkkn] p[data-astro-cid-gt4hgkkn]{font-size:15px;line-height:1.9}.cta-copy[data-astro-cid-gt4hgkkn] .hero-cta[data-astro-cid-gt4hgkkn]{margin-top:22px}}@media(max-width:430px){.partner-hero[data-astro-cid-gt4hgkkn]{min-height:728px}.hero-copy[data-astro-cid-gt4hgkkn]{width:calc(100% - 48px);padding-top:138px}}
